Progress being made on water supply hookups

Friday, October 8, 2010

BENTON -- A lot of progress is being made on the Scott County Public Water Supply District No. 4, and the first hookups should be made within week.

On Thursday, Tim McIntyre, system manager, met with county commissioners to give an update on the project. In May, it hit a snag when the contractor was terminated, but a new company is now on board and and getting things moving.

McIntyre said it appears the Kelly School District should have water next week, and Scott County Central within the next two weeks.

"We're really excited to see this starting up again," said Commissioner Dennis Ziegenhorn. He also noted that everyone involved in the project is pleased with the patience of customers through the snags.
